Create zines, comics, artist books, and other paper-based projects in a relaxed library setting. The evening begins with a brief introduction to the history of zines from self-published pamphlets and underground comics to punk, political, and DIY movements, followed by time to make your own work. The library provides drawing supplies, paper, adhesives, scissors, discarded book pages, staplers, trimmers, bookbinding tools, scanners, and free photocopying. A flexible theme will spark ideas and encourage experimentation, making this program welcoming for all skill levels.
